I want to recommend this game - Not for what it is now, but for what it will/can become.

Let me put it bluntly, if you're buying this game now, don't buy it for the strategy side of it, it's non-existant, and horribly imbalanced. Archers don't do anything, mercenary units (That the AI recruits at least) are constant and he will overwhelm you non-stop. There's no Cavalry, there's a half-finished development system, 1/5th policy system and a "production tab" with no information in it. Looking at the pre-alpha video above, it's hard to understand why so much awesome stuff has been cut away, or why so many things are missing - And why regiment size is only 36?!

I really don't know how to continue staying somewhat positive here, but I will try...

If you're buying this for the city-builder aspect of it, like Anno etc. Then get it now, it's wonderful, it's beautiful and it's great.

There's a TON of features not implimented yet, there's placeholders and things that all together just don't do anything.

For instance, building a great big manor is all nice and well, but if your enemy marches by, your towers, garrison etc, don't do anything, cause they're technically not there.

It's hard for me to choose between yes or no on the button below and my opinion may change later - however, I feel, trust and believe in both the developer and the publisher - this game will deliver everything that we want - it's just a question of when.

Let. it. cook - Buy it now, and play it once or twice, then wait for the updates to hit... There's about 6-8 hours of gameplay right now in the game.

TL;DR: I cannot recommend this game as a strategy game, not yet - but I can recommend it as a city-builder. And that weighs my review more to 'no' than 'yes'.

I'm not entirely sure where I stand on this game...

On one hand, I didn't play the first, and I know that's a detriment in some ways, because I'm not 'familiar' with the playstyle or the game itself.

However, when it comes to the game itself... I feel like it's just.... not made for PC at all..
Controls are wonky with keyboard and mouse (Granted, the game even pops up saying "hey grab a controller, it's better!") but that just... doesn't justify it to me. I know, I'm pretty set in my ways, laugh all you want.

Then there's the camera motions, the movement, feels... janky, clonky? I don't know, it just feels *Off*

In a singleplayer game.... What exactly is the reason to limit your characters weight to a mere 25-30 kg worth of items? Loads of people are hoarders, we wanna loot everything, craft everything and do everything... To me, it takes enjoyment away when most of the game I have to waddle around cause I'm 50kg overweight and gets agitated when my pawns take loot. (great mechanic though!)

I ABSOLUTELY do not understand the idea of losing maximum HP by simply running around and exploring, what the actual **** is that mechanic? The longer I'm running around exploring, exerting myself, fighting etc, the more maximum hp I lose? WHY for the love of all that's holy am I being PUNISHED for playing the game extended amounts of time, to the point a goblin can sneeze at me and I die - going back to the games last autosave?!?! Seriously?! WHY?!

I really wanted to enjoy it, but these things are just... massively detrimental to what I'd call a good game.... Maybe someone will grace me with some mods to fix this, maybe not... Either way... It's gonna be a no thanks for now.

Oh... and then the flipping last second microtransactions... Stop flipping out about it, you earn massive amounts of them ingame by simply just playing... - but it's still a bad move to drop them on a game that already costs 60+ euro.. jesus F christ capcom...
